What the 10M50DAF256I6G is and where it fits

The Intel 10M50DAF256I6G is a MAX® 10 family FPGA with 50000 logic elements and 178 user I/O in a 256-FBGA package. It carries 1677312 bits of embedded RAM.

Temperature grade and environment

The -40°C to 100°C junction temperature range covers industrial and extended-industrial applications.

Frequently asked questions

What is the exact operating temperature range of 10M50DAF256I6G?

The junction temperature range is -40°C to 100°C (TJ). This is the die temperature, not ambient — the designer must account for self-heating.

Does 10M50DAF256I6G have any direct replacement from Intel?

Intel lists no direct replacement for this active part. The 10M40DAF256I6G is a lower-density sibling in the same package and pinout, but it is a functional alternative only if the design fits within 40 000 logic elements.
